The forecast for Business Enterprise R&D Expenditure in Financial and Insurance Activities in Japan shows a steady increase from 2024 to 2028, with values rising from 9.29 billion Japanese Yens in 2024 to 11.74 billion Yens in 2028. This indicates growing investment in R&D by 2028 compared to the baseline of 8.67 billion Yens in 2023.
Year-over-year growth is projected as follows:
- 2025: 6.67%
- 2026: 6.26%
- 2027: 5.79%
- 2028: 5.39%
The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) from 2024 to 2028 is approximately 5.98%, underlining the consistent upward trend.
